Getting to sync - advice
 
Hello,

I posted this in the non-linear section, too -- but since it's more of a sound issue I thought of looking for advice here, as well.

My FCP HD set-up is as follows (I have an Apple G5):

- for video, I use Blackmagic Decklink Pro to send the signal to a good JVC CRT monitor (TM-H1750C)
- for audio, I use the Digidesign M-Box (connected to my G5 through USB) to send the sound out to a pair of m-audio bx8 speakers

Everything is fine except that I do not have sync between the video and audio when editing. I think it's the video that takes a while longer to reach the JVC monitor.

What is the best option to have such a set-up work at its best? Anyone has the same set-up and can give me some advice?

I could mention that the Decklink has also audio outputs but since it's a card built primarily for video I am wondering about its sound quality as compared to the M-Box.

Thanks for any suggestions!

Douglas Spotted Eagle September 12th, 2005 08:56 AM

Use the audio on the Decklink. It's very good, and it's buffered correctly for the video send. The MBox is not. the audio quality of the Decklink is likely higher quality as well. I don't use the Decklink with my FCP system, but I do use it with my PC system. It sounds great, even through a hyper-suite of Hothouse monitors. M-box isn't bad by any means either, but if you've got good sound on the Decklink, use it.
